Warning Signs You Need Wall Water Damage Repair
Don’t ignore these warning signs – they can save you money and prevent bigger problems down the line. If you notice any of these signs, call us right away.
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Unpleasant odors can be a sign of hidden moisture in your walls. If you notice a musty smell that won’t go away, it’s time to call us.
Water Stains on Your Walls
Water stains can be a sign of a bigger problem. If you notice water stains on your walls, don’t ignore them – call us to assess the damage.
Peeling Paint or Wallpaper
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of moisture damage. If you notice peeling paint or wallpaper, it’s time to call us.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. If you notice warped or buckled flooring, don’t ignore it – call us to assess the damage.
Visible Water Damage on Your Ceilings
Visible water damage on your ceilings can be a sign of a bigger problem. If you notice water damage on your ceilings, call us right away.
Unexplained Mold or Mildew Growth
Mold or mildew growth can be a sign of hidden moisture in your walls. If you notice unexplained mold or mildew growth, it’s time to call us.

Wall Water Damage Repair Cost in Nahunta, GA
The cost of Wall Water Damage Repair varies based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Nahunta, GA. These are estimates, not guarantees.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ed |
| Repair and Reconstruction |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, type of materials needed |
| Final Inspection and Cleanup |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ed |
| Emergency Service Call | $200 – $1,000 | Time of day, distance to property |
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ment. Free estimates are available.

What Causes Wall Water Damage?
Wall water damage can be caused by a variety of factors, including burst pipes, overflowing toilets, and heavy rainfall. It’s essential to address the issue quickly to prevent further damage.
Is Wall Water Damage Repair Covered by Insurance?
Yes, wall water damage repair is typically covered by insurance. We’ll work with your insurance company to ensure a smooth claims process.
Can I Prevent Wall Water Damage?
Yes, you can prevent wall water damage by addressing any leaks or water issues quickly, keeping your gutters clean, and ensuring your property is well-maintained.
